Transaction 31865c2a6bc23b60225a7426967ed3c0dc298e345082717bc3b6d2726e3ae95b
1 Input
1 Output
-
31865c2a6bc23b60225a7426967ed3c0dc298e345082717bc3b6d2726e3ae95b:0
- value
- 3524609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a45065cddcd7328eec0992a8f633cb1ede775a9 OP_EQUAL
- address
- 3QWKYS2cNakvs1cWtFhbbVQHq1gbeA9uBN